$BTC A short story is a fictional narrative, usually under 10,000 words, that can be read in one sitting and often focuses on a single event or a few characters. Here's a bit more detail about short stories:
Length:
While there's no strict definition, a short story typically falls between 5 and 60 pages.
Focus:
They often concentrate on a single event or a small group of characters.
Readability:
They are designed to be read in a single sitting, usually within an hour or two.
